Elevating & Acknowledging Women's Role in Agripreneurship

The theme for IWD 2025 #AccelerateAction calls for collective action to speed up progress toward gender equality. Collective action and shared ownership for driving gender parity is what makes IWD impactful. The day also marks a call to action for accelerating women's equality. India's development journey is closely interlinked with the empowerment of its women. Recognising this critical connection, the central government has placed Nari Shakti at the forefront of its agenda over the past ten years. The government understands that women's empowerment is not a one- time solution; it requires a comprehensive approach that addresses their needs throughout their lives. "We need to focus on the poor, women, youth and farmers," mentioned the Finance Minister in her Budget Speech, reiterating the government's commitment to economic empowerment. A crucial aspect of this vision is increasing women's participation in the workforce, with a target of 70 per cent participation. This emphasis underscores the government's broad approach to fostering economic growth and inclusivity.

India's female workforce participation rate peaked in 2004–05 at 40.8 per cent, although it has subsequently fallen since then. However, following years of decrease, the female labour force participation rate (FLPR) has been trending upward since 2017. Notably, the rural FLPR has shown remarkable growth, rising from 41.5 per cent in 2022–23 to 47.6 per cent in 2023–24. A key driver behind this increase is the rise in self-employed women, especially in the agricultural sector. State-level census data analysis further supports this, highlighting the significance of agriculture in boosting women's labour participation. These trends signify a positive shift in India's workforce landscape and emphasise the importance of supporting women's entrepreneurship, particularly in agriculture.
